The first thing a job recruiter notices about any resume is the layout.

Does it look organized or cluttered? Is it too short or too long? Is it boring and easy to ignore, or does it scream out Read me!?

Here are some of the best practices when it comes to your resume layout:

Resume Layout Must-Haves

1. One page in length. You should only go for 2 pages if you really, really believe that itll add significant value. HR managers in big firms get around 1,000+ resumes per month. Theyre not going to spend their valuable time reading your life story!

2. Clear section headings. Pick a heading and use it for all the section headers.

3. Ample white-space, especially around the margins.

4. Easy-to-read font. Wed recommend sticking to what stands out, but not too much. Do: Ubuntu, Roboto, Overpass, etc. Dont : Comic Sans

5. Pick the right font size. As a rule of thumb, go for 11 – 12 pt for normal text, and 14 – 16 pt for section titles.

6. As a rule of thumb, save your resume as PDF. Word is a popular alternative, but it has a good chance of messing up your resume formatting.

One more thing you need to consider in terms of resume layout is whether youre going for a traditional-looking free resume template or something a bit more modern:

If youre pursuing a career in a more traditional industry – legal, banking, finance, etc. – you might want to stick to the first.

    Reach Out To Your Network

    Arranging informational interviews with people you are connected to can also help your resume stand out, according to Schweikert. Most applications are submitted online, and the volume of resumes that hiring managers must sift through can be overwhelming at times so establishing a personal connection can help you get noticed, she says. Plus, if you are invited in for an official interview, you can bring up what you discussed at the informational one. You can say, hey I did a lot of research on the organization and met with Susie Q and they shared this with me,’ Schweikert says.

    After your informational interview, you can reach out to that contact and ask that they glance over your resume, making sure to pose as many specific questions as possible about how you should tailor your resume to the company or specific role, Schweikert adds. For example, if you are struggling to decide whether to include your college activities on your resume, reaching out to your connection for advice can provide invaluable insight on whether that might be important to that company.

    Kim also encourages informational interviews, as they are a great opportunity to learn more about an industry, company or specific role. There is also significant value in having someone else look over your resume. A second pair of eyes can bring a lot of fresh perspective, she says.

    Dont Worry Too Much About Gaps

    Top Employee Relations Resume Examples &  Samples for 2020 ...

    One of the questions that Lees and Heifetz get asked regularly is how to account for gaps in a resume, perhaps when you werent working or took time off to care for a family member. If you were doing something during that time that might be relevant to the job, you can include it. Or you might consider explaining the gap in your cover letter, as long as you have a brief, positive explanation. However, the good news is that in todays job market, hiring professionals are much more forgiving of gaps. In a recent survey, 87% of hiring managers said that they no longer see candidates being unemployed or having an employment gap as a red flag.

    Use Similar Terms And Address Every Required Qualification

    Your experience needs to address every required qualification in the job announcement. Hiring agencies will look for specific terms in your resume to make sure you have the experience theyre seeking.

    For example, if the qualifications section says you need experience with MS Project you need to use the words MS Project in your resume.

    Customize Your Resume For Your Industry

    People are often encouraged to include personality in their resume, but unless they are applying for a job in a creative industry, they may want to rethink that strategy. A lot of pictures and fonts and colors and a whole lot of personality just doesnt align with the jobs we have here, says Schweikert, whose team recruits for positions in sales, product and marketing. If I was in an organization that, for example, was in web design, then I would want to see those design elements in a resume.

    Kim agrees that resume layout is wholly dependent on the position you are applying for. If you are applying for a designer role, I want to see something creative there. If youre applying for a finance role, I want to see numbers, she says.
